Let’s get a little technical

The Vertuo system introduces centrifusion technology as well as a new range of coffee capsule sizes, allowing for a variety of coffee types. The clever technology reads and recognises the unique barcode on each capsule at the press of a button, regulating the flow and volume of water, temperature, infusion duration, and capsule rotation to extract a high grade dark, full-bodied coffee with a silky and generous crema.

Nespresso South Africa presently offers three Vertuo Next versions in sleek and modern colours: Nespresso Vertuo Next, Vertuo Next Premium, and Vertuo Next Deluxe. All of the machines use centrifusion technology and have a simple one-touch button. Visit za.buynespresso.com for additional information on each machine.

The Vertuo Next

Nespresso Vertuo Next is available in three models, Vertuo Next, Vertuo Next Premium and Vertuo Next Deluxe.

The new Vertuo Next, which is the one I have, can make coffee in five different serving sizes: Carafe Pour-Over Style (535ml), Signature Coffee Mug (230ml), Gran Lungo (150ml), Double Espresso (80ml), and Espresso (100ml) (40ml).

Coffee enthusiasts can enjoy over 30 superb permanent coffees as well as seasonal limited editions:

  • 1 blend in Carafe Pour-Over Style
  • 13 blends or single origins for mug size
  • 6 single origin blends for Gran Lungo size
  • 3 blends for Double Espresso size
  • 7 blends for Espresso size

The various-sized capsules are designed to fit a variety of coffee cup sizes, and each is meticulously blended and roasted to give a high-quality coffee experience.

Features

The innovative new Vertuo Next machine range and the new coffees offer a variety of new features, all designed to enrich the experience:

  • New centrifusion extraction (rotational extraction) system to gently and precisely brew coffee. The rotation reaches up to 4000 rotations per minute to fully extract the coffee.
  • Barcode reading technology which adjusts the brewing parameters such as the cup size, temperature, rotational speed, flow rate and time the water is in contact with the coffee to allow for precise extraction.
  • Simple and convenient one button operation
  • Vertuo Next features an automatic opening and closing of the machine head.
  • 30 second pre-heating time, with the signature mug size (230ml) extracted in under 70 seconds.
  • Adjustable cup platform for Espresso, Double Espresso, Gran Lungo, Signature Coffee Mug, Carafe Pour-Over style, Recipe Glasses as well as the Travel Mug.
  • Automatic off mode after 2 minutes of non-use

Sustainability is at the heart of everything Nespresso does, and drives a commitment to making a positive difference for people and the planet. To that end, all Nespresso coffee capsules, including the Vertuo line, are made up of aluminium, which is recyclable. It’s the best way to protect freshness of the product, not to mention the quality and taste.

Nespresso has also invested in its recycling initiatives and is devoted to making it easy and quick for customers to recycle their used capsules.

And finally, all Nespresso systems include an energy-saving mode or automatic power-off mechanism to reduce energy use.

Vertuo Next machines are produced from more than 50% recycled plastics and have a totally recyclable pack comprised of 99.5% recycled material: recycled paper, moulded paper, and paper foil to protect the machine from scratches. By the end of 2021, all Nespresso machines will have this revolutionary packaging.
